Human-Robot Collaboration for Industrial Environments

SPARCL's collaborative robotics (cobot) systems are engineered for safe operation alongside human technicians in aviation maintenance environments. Every system meets or exceeds ISO 10218 and ISO/TS 15066 safety standards.

Safety Features

  • Collision detection with force-limited joints (under 150N contact force)
  • Configurable safety protection zones with real-time boundary enforcement
  • Emergency stop integration with existing facility safety systems
  • Speed and separation monitoring via 3D depth cameras
  • Hand-guiding mode for intuitive manual positioning

Collaboration Modes

Our systems support multiple interaction paradigms: full autonomy for repetitive tasks, shared workspace where humans and robots operate in the same area, and direct hand-guiding for teaching new procedures. Operators can seamlessly switch between modes based on the task requirements.
